Wpis z mikrobloga

ze sql to cien przeszlosci


@msq: Dwa tygodnie temu gadałem z takim jednym delikwentem z popularnego portalu aukcyjnego.

Trochę go naprostowałem.

Ale zacząłem się bardziej nosqlem interesować.

Różnica jest zasadnicza. W pewnych rozwiązaniach nosql (w obecnej formie) nigdy nie przejdzie.
  • Odpowiedz
@aaandrzeeey: No tak, pojawiaja sie juz nosqle obslugujace transakcje - na przyklad foundation db. Ale nie wyborazam sobie uzyc tego do projektu ktory z definicji wymaga relacyjnosci z tej postej przyczyny ze nie widze sensu w przenoszeniu do aplikacji funkcjonalnosci ktora w bazie relacyjnej mam na dziendobry.

Jest problem przy skalowaniu takich baz w gore, ale jesli ktos mi mowi ze baza sql nieuciagnie paru milionow rekordow to zwykle trudno mi
  • Odpowiedz
baza sql nieuciagnie paru milionow


@msq: Tu chodzi o miliardy. Jak są to logi, czy wyniki wyszukiwania, gdzie nie musisz mieć 100% pewności, a prawdopodobieństwo to nosql może mieć uzasadnienie.

Bazy k-dziesiąt GB, po kilkadziesiąt milionów rekordów działają spokojnie nawet na MySQL-u

Kwestia dobrego projektu, indeksowania, zasoby itd...

pojawiaja sie juz nosqle obslugujace transakcje


Mimo to nie wyobrażam sobie nosqla w systemie, w którym "hajs się musi zgadzać"
  • Odpowiedz